What problem does it solve?

This Skill solves the complexity and version-specific challenges of programmatically creating and managing materials and shader nodes in Blender, ensuring your code works across different Blender versions.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Node Tree Construction: Build complex shader networks from scratch or modify existing ones.
  • Version Compatibility: Handles API changes between Blender 3.x, 4.x, and 5.x, especially for the Principled BSDF node.
  • Texture & UV Mapping: Set up image textures, UV coordinates, and normal maps correctly.
  • Use Case: Automatically generate PBR materials with diffuse, roughness, and normal maps for architectural visualizations, ensuring consistency across Blender 3.6 and 4.1 projects.
